Kansas City, MO (SportsNetwork.com) - Kansas City Chiefs tackle Branden Albert and linebacker Justin Houston are both inactive for Sunday's game against the Indianapolis Colts.
Albert has missed three straight games with a knee injury, while Houston has sat out four in a row with a subluxation of his right elbow.
Tight end Anthony Fasano (concussion/knee) and punt returner/wide receiver Dexter McCluster (ankle) are both listed as active.
